Bluebell Ritual: A Crisp Green Floral Debut
Scents of Man introduces Bluebell Ritual, a women's fragrance debuting in 2026. It belongs to the green floral fragrance family and was crafted by perfumer Andrea Byrne.
The name points to the bluebell, which shows up in both the top and heart notes. The scent has a bright, botanical feel, with a touch of powdery softness and a watery, airy undertone.
The top note blend features heliotrope, bergamot, bluebell and grass. Heliotrope adds a soft, sweet floral warmth, bergamot gives a polished citrus spark, and the bluebell and grass reinforce the green, just-picked atmosphere.
Magnolia, bluebell, jasmine and iris form the heart. This is where the fragrance becomes quietly sophisticated: the magnolia gives creamy volume, the jasmine adds a touch of sparkle, and the iris keeps everything smooth and powdery.
The base relies on violet leaves, orris root, galbanum and vetiver. This green and slightly earthy foundation supports the florals beautifully, adding a woody nuance that feels refined rather than heavy.
With accords like green, ozonic, fresh, powdery, iris, aquatic, white floral, vanilla and citrus, Bluebell Ritual reads as modern and easy to wear. It fits a casual daytime wardrobe just as well as a more polished spring ensemble.
